fsMIIpv6ScopeZoneCreationStatus
ARICENT-MIIPV6-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.4.1.29601.2.35.1.14.1.4
Object
column
Enumeration
Flag to determine if the scope-zone index is configured automatically or by configuration.When an IPv6 interface is created by default the linklocal scope is created and the creation status of it is automatic.When a user creates a scope-zone the creation status is updated as manual.When an indication is receievd from higher layer protocol regarding the detection of interfaces on the same link, in that case whatever might be the configuration status (i.e automatic or manual) is changed to overridden. It means if the scope-zone on the standby links if its automatic or manually created both will be over-ridden and configured with the scope-zone of the active link
